Обязанности:
Core — IT-компания, предоставляющая аутстаффинг для банков и корпораций. Наш клиент — крупный сервис по недвижимости (цифровые инструменты для поиска, покупки, аренды и оформления сделок). Вы будете работать над интерфейсами высоконагруженного B2C-продукта с многомиллионной аудиторией.Проект: Наши проекты объединяет в одном месте персонализированные рекомендации AI, обучающие курсы, цели развития, ежедневный контент и события — всё, что нужно для профессионального развития. Архитектура построена на микрофронтендах. Проект - это не просто каталог курсов, а умная система, которая помогает каждому сотруднику строить свой путь роста на основе текущих целей, интересов и роли в компании. Технологический стек: Core Stack: - TypeScript — строгая типизация, strict mode - React — функциональный стиль с JSX - styled-components — основная библиотека для стилизации - React Query — управление серверным состоянием - Storeon — глобальное состояние приложения Сборка: - Webpack 5 — сборка микрофронтендов - ESLint + Prettier — код-стайл и линтинг Testing и Quality: - Jest — unit/integration тесты - MSW — mock service worker для API моков - SonarQube — отчеты по качеству кода Обязательные требования: - Опыт разработки JS/TS, React от трёх лет - Глубокие знания ES6+ - Умение работать с сборщиками Webpack - Опыт работы с git - Опыт работы с TypeScript - Понимание React Query или аналогов (кэширование, refetch, suspense) - Опыт работы с styled-components или CSS-in-JS решений - Понимание архитектуры микрофронтендов - Опыт работы с Storeon/Redux - Понимание tokenization и работой с дизайн-системой - Опыт интеграции AI-ассистентов в процесс разработки: использование плагинов для IDE и взаимодействие с AI-агентами через интерфейс командной строки (CLI). - Понимание skill-based development — создание custom AI skills для автоматизации повторяющихся задач - Умение применять созданные AI Skills для повседневной разработки - Опыт разработки и настройки субагентов для специфических задач проекта - Понимание MCP (Model Context Protocol) — протокола для обмена контекстом между AI-системами Условия: Удаленный формат работы на территории РФ Сотрудничество по ИП При необходимости выдается оборудованиеПохожие вакансии
Договорная
Москва. Станции метро: Пушкинская, Белорусская, Маяковская, Тверская
МТС Банк
Договорная
Москва. Станции метро: Пушкинская, Белорусская, Маяковская, Тверская
Первый канал
От 27 093 руб.
Москва. Станции метро: Пушкинская, Белорусская, Маяковская, Тверская
ФГБУ ГИВЦ Минкультуры России
От 120 000 до 180 000 руб.
Москва. Станции метро: Пушкинская, Белорусская, Маяковская, Тверская
ПОСМ.РЦ.
Договорная
Москва. Станции метро: Пушкинская, Белорусская, Маяковская, Тверская
Orion soft
Договорная
Москва. Станции метро: Пушкинская, Белорусская, Маяковская, Тверская
ВТБ Специализированный депозитарий